Why Speed Matters in Emergency Weather Alerts
Rapid dissemination of weather warnings allows individuals and organizations to take prompt action, potentially saving lives and minimizing property damage. Delays in alerting can lead to inadequate preparation and increased risk.
Key Components of a Swift Alert System
To achieve a sub-five-minute alert system, consider the following components:
-
Real-Time Data Integration: Utilize platforms that provide immediate access to weather data from authoritative sources like the National Weather Service (NWS).
-
Automated Alert Generation: Implement systems that automatically generate alerts based on predefined criteria, reducing manual intervention and potential delays.
-
Multi-Channel Distribution: Distribute alerts across various channels—such as SMS, email, voice calls, and social media—to ensure broad reach and accessibility.
-
User-Centric Customization: Allow users to set preferences for the types of alerts they receive and the channels through which they are notified, enhancing relevance and engagement.
Implementing the Workflow
Setting up an efficient emergency weather alerts system involves the following steps:
-
Select a Reliable Alert Platform: Choose a platform that integrates seamlessly with NWS data and supports rapid, multi-channel alert distribution.
-
Configure Alert Parameters: Define the specific weather conditions that will trigger alerts, such as severe thunderstorms, tornadoes, or flash floods.
-
Set Up Distribution Channels: Ensure the system can send alerts via multiple channels to reach the intended audience effectively.
-
Test the System: Conduct regular tests to verify the system's responsiveness and the accuracy of the alerts.
-
Monitor and Optimize: Continuously monitor the system's performance and make necessary adjustments to improve efficiency and reliability.
